Welcome aboard — this covers the font vendoring handoff for the Quillway platform. All third-party typefaces live in the vendored-fonts repo; we never pull them at build time. When a foundry updates a family, Dorn's script normalizes the metrics and regenerates the manifest. Check licenses before merging anything new — the audit sheet in the repo wiki lists what's cleared. Releases go out monthly with the font bundle checksummed and signed. Sign the bundle manifest using the key that follows.

release key, hadug-kawef: bky13_mPGeFZeR1GZ1G

**Ticket: Fleet fuel-usage report exposes raw telemetry paths**

Severity: Medium. The monthly fuel-usage report generated by Haulmetric's Fleetwise module embeds absolute filesystem paths from the aggregation host in its footer metadata. While no credentials are leaked, the paths reveal internal directory structure that could aid reconnaissance. Reproduced on staging by exporting the Tallgrove depot report. Sanitization should occur in the export layer, not the template. The affected build is identified below.

session token of yajof-bagef = htk4_937d

Leadership Review Briefing — Regional Sales
For: Finance Team

Quick snapshot: the Merrowvale region beat target by 6%, mostly thanks to the Lanternbox bundle. Caldris lagged again — third quarter running — and we're reworking territory splits there. Pipeline looks decent overall. Context on why we're holding Caldris investment steady is in the confidential note below.

board note of bawep-taweg: Soriusix Foods plans to lower the Kelys list price by 52 percent in October.

- [ ] Verify timezone handling in Ledgermill report exports. New team members: exports must render timestamps in the workspace's configured zone, not server UTC, and DST boundaries near the export window are the usual failure point. Run the cross-zone fixture suite before sign-off. Record the passing run's token immediately below this item.

session token of kageg-tahop = htk14_af3c1ccccb7dcf